Unveiling the Faces of Mental Illness
The individuals featured in "33 Voices" come from all walks of life: athletes, actors, musicians, politicians, business leaders, and more. Their stories reveal that mental illness does not discriminate. It can affect anyone, regardless of age, race, gender, or socioeconomic status.
Reading these accounts is like stepping into the shoes of another person, experiencing their struggles and triumphs. It provides a level of empathy and understanding that can be hard to find elsewhere.
Strategies for Overcoming Challenges
While the experiences shared in "33 Voices" are unique, the lessons learned are universal. These individuals offer practical advice and coping mechanisms that can benefit anyone facing mental health challenges.
They discuss the importance of seeking professional help, practicing self-care, and building a support system. They also emphasize the transformative power of sharing one's story and connecting with others who understand.
The strategies presented in the book are not just for those directly affected by mental illness. They also serve as valuable tools for family members, friends, and caregivers seeking to provide support and understanding.
